The Price is Right...Maybe?
Here's the thing about Rangers tickets: they're like fancy cheese – there's a wide range, and the price can vary wildly. We're talking anywhere from "just found a fiver under the couch" to "holy Gretzky, that's more than my rent!"
Here's a breakdown to get you started:
- The Early Bird Gets the Discount: Snag tickets early enough, and you might find a steal. Think evenings against, uh, let's say, less-popular teams.
- Location, Location, Location: Just like real estate, seat location is key. Front row seats next to MSG Jesus (Lundqvist's statue, for those new to the game) will cost more than nosebleeds.
- Playoff Fever? The hotter the competition, the steeper the price. Stanley Cup Finals? Better start saving those pennies (or nickels, at this rate).
So, How Much Are We Talking?
Alright, alright, you came here for numbers. Here's a ballpark estimate (pun intended):
- Budget-Friendly Fanatic: You could snag a seat for as low as $245. Just be prepared to share the hot dog with your neighbor.
- The Average Joe: The typical Rangers ticket goes for around $1,316. This gets you a decent seat and bragging rights (kind of).
- High Rollin' Hockey Head: If you're feeling fancy (or have a really generous boss), you could be looking at $2,929 or more for prime playoff seats. Just remember, with great seats comes great responsibility (to cheer like crazy).
Bonus Tip: There's no shame in exploring the secondary market ([secondary ticketing sites]), but be cautious! Do your research and buy from reputable sellers.
